ARCO Rights
You can exercise your rights of Access, Rectification, Cancellation or Opposition (ARCO) by sending an email to hola@toroto.mx or in writing with acknowledgment of receipt. The request must contain:
(i) Full name, address and means of contact.
(ii) Identity documents.
(iii) Clear description of the data you want to exercise your rights over.
(iv) In case of rectification, indicate modifications and supporting documents.
Toroto will respond within 20 business days and, if appropriate, will take effect within 15 days. In case of incomplete information, the applicant may be requested within 5 days.
Revocation
The Owner may revoke their consent at any time following the same procedure as ARCO rights, unless this prevents them from complying with obligations deriving from a current legal relationship.
